CASILLAS v. PERALES


154 A.D.2d 420 (1989)

William Casillas et al., Individually and on Behalf of All Other Persons Similarly Situated, Respondents, v. Cesar Perales, as Commissioner of The New York State Department of Social Services, Appellant, et al., Defendant

Appellate Division of the Supreme Court of the State of New York, Second Department.

October 10, 1989


Ordered that the order is modified, on the law, by deleting the provision thereof which denied those branches of the defendant's motion which were to dismiss those parts of the complaint that asserted claims for damages against him and for attorney's fees, and substituting therefor a provision granting those branches of his motion; and, as so modified, the order is affirmed insofar as appealed from, without costs or disbursements.
